This problem occurs because when a user opens a file in eRoom to edit through the option 'edit': the file becomes reserved for editions.
This is because only one user can edit a file at the time.

In order to solve this issue, We have to follow the below procedure.

  • We should ask the users to clear the Internet explorer cache.
    For clearing the Internet explorer cache we can provide the below link for guidance.

          How to Delete Temporary Internet Files, Cookies, and Browsing History of the Internet Browser 

  •   Open Eroom and choose "eRoom plugin software" option.



  • After that, the user has two options to edit a file in eRoom:

              1) Clicking directly in the file name.
                 It won't reserve the file for editions in eRoom.

            2) Clicking the option 'edit'. When the user goes to edit a file and finishes editing, the user needed to select an option between:Save or not save


  • After that the browser should be reloaded to release the document for editions.
